TIMELINE Slackware64 : From the initial public release of Slackware64-current to now


- 2009/05/19 : Initial public release of Slackware64-current
------------------------
- 2009/07/01 : 13.0 RC 1
- 2009/08/06 : 13.0 RC 2
- 2009/08/26 : 13.0 stable
------------------------
- 2010/05/06 : 13.1 beta
- 2010/05/14 : 13.1 RC 1
- 2010/05/18 : 13.1 RC 2
- 2010/05/19 : 13.1 stable
------------------------
- 2011/03/09 : 13.37 RC 1
- 2011/03/16 : 13.37 RC 2
- 2011/04/25 : 13.37 stable
------------------------
- 2012/07/22 : 14.0 beta
- 2012/08/09 : 14.0 RC 1
- 2012/08/16 : 14.0 RC 2
- 2012/08/24 : 14.0 RC 3
- 2012/09/04 : 14.0 RC 4
- 2012/09/19 : 14.0 RC 5
- 2012/09/26 : 14.0 stable
------------------------
- 2013/08/06 : 14.1 alpha
- 2013/09/18 : 14.1 beta
- 2013/10/14 : 14.1 RC 1
- 2013/10/21 : 14.1 RC 2
- 2013/10/28 : 14.1 RC 3
- 2013/11/04 : 14.1 stable
------------------------
- 2015/11/14 : 14.2 almost beta
- 2016/01/13 : 14.2 beta 1
- 2016/03/17 : 14.2 RC 1
- 2016/04/15 : 14.2 RC 2
- 2016/06/30 : 14.2 stable
------------------------
- 2021/02/15 : 15.0 alpha 1
- 2021/04/06 : 15.0 almost beta 1
- 2021/04/12 : 15.0 beta
